SCAM your CREDIT CARD False advertising Offer free consultation on line with no obligation then they call saying a Doctors will give you a consultation and request a blood test for further assessment to see if you are suitable for 12 month programme. The cost of Dr to call is $50 then they Debit Your Credit Card for $2495 and the Dr never rings will NOT refund money. They will threaten you with a verbal recorded contract taken over the phone and will not send a copy. They do not respond to emails. This Company is based in Sydney Australia.

Scam -
HI-- pressure phone sales "people". Will get you one way or another to give them your credit card details--then its all over. Their only interest is getting your $2495. 00! For the "testosterone cream". They claim that the procedure is that a "doctor" will call you --and --only after you have had a blood test ---and its analysed by (their) doctor AND he/she decides you are "suitable" --then you will proceed with the "programme."
Here is what happened to me:- I had a fatigue problem and thought that this may help--mistake no. 1--see your own doctor first!
I was talked into a 400.00 payment to get started, and some days layer a "doctor" (medicare provider number supplied--but I don't think that makes them a doctor) calle me and asked me a list of standard questions--and then sent me a Pathology request form--which I have subsequently lost.
I tried for days to contact the "doctor" and could only slueth out a Physiotherapy clinic in Adelaide--who said she wasnt there and "doesn't take messages"--and since then Supplemax says "she doesn't work for us any more"
30 days layer my Credit Card was billed 197.00--as if the "programme" has started--but I havent had any "cream" delivered--nor has any "doctor" looked at my Pathology results (which I still havent had) to authorise this Prescription medication under Aust Govt guidelines (or not).
Called Supplemax, who said --its my fault--and that the pathology should be still done and the Office Manager! Must be notified because "we have thousands of tests done and after 5 days the blood is scrapped"? No mention about who is going to "analyse" the blood from the blood test --maybe the Office Manager!
I asked --(tricked them by calling from a number they didnt have--they thought I was a new "customer")-what happens if the Supplemax "doctor" says go ahead--and my own G. P. says not suitable?
Reply--"we will send you the medication anyway, and it up to you if you use it"! Preposterous and illegal under the Act!
They will threaten you with your "verbal (recorded) contract " as if there is no possible way out of it--but the facts here are that they are debiting my card in breach of their own specified procedures!--and obviously intend to keep debiting it regardless.
They do not answer or return calls--and especially ignore emails-- (once you have given your details, your phone number is in their system--and they dont/wont answer once they have your "contract" in place.
If you deal with this outfit --beware!--demand that all details be in written form --email or paper mail--including all conditions, procedures and payments.If they balk at this --then they are not legitimate --or 'ethical", and shouldn't be dealt with.
